Our Department of Education is seeking applicants for a pool of temporary Instructors available to teach for the 2018-2019 academic year. Specific needs include: children's literature, literacy (early childhood and elementary reading specialist), and special education (early childhood, elementary, secondary).

Qualifications
Required academic qualification to be eligible for the Instructor position is a Masters degree from an accredited institution in education or field related to specific teaching assignment. Required academic qualification to be eligible for the Assistant Professor position is a Doctorate from an accredited institution in education or field related to specific teaching assignment.
Required experience for Instructor and Assistant Professor positions include: capacity for successful teaching at the university level, demonstrated excellence in written communication skills, commitment to the education of racially and linguistically diverse populations.
Preferred experience for Instructor and Assistant Professor positions include: two or more years teaching experience in P-12 schools, two or more years teaching experience at the university level, experience with and commitment to working with students from diverse population groups, evidence of ability to integrate diversity issues into the curriculum, experience teaching with technology and evidence of ability to integrate technology into the curriculum.

About the Job
***This is a faculty position***
Responsibilities may include teaching courses in one or more of the following areas: children's literature, literacy (early childhood & elementary reading specialist), special education (early childhood, elementary, secondary), elementary education, early childhood education, secondary education, American Sign Language, Academic English Language Program, education administration, graduate programs, human diversity, technology, advising education students, supervising student teacher candidates, serving on committees, and other duties as assigned.
